Nodes & Testnets
June 29

Запуск ноды Nubit на DigitalOcean

Что такое DigitalOcean

DigitalOcean — это американский провайдер виртуальных частных серверов. Ведущий поставщик облачной инфраструктуры, предлагающий разработчикам простую в использовании, гибкую и масштабируемую платформу для развертывания, управления и масштабирования приложений.

Возможности DigitalOcean:

  • Развёртывание платформы в несколько кликов из панели управления.
  • Масштабирование приложений с помощью API и плавучих IP.
  • Выбор регионов ЦОД по всему миру.
  • SSD-диски для повышения производительности.
  • Серверы обладают сетевым интерфейсом на 1 Гбит / сек.
  • KVM-виртуализация для повышения уровня скорости и защиты.
  • Серверы построены на мощных машинах с выделенной ECC памятью и SSD RAID-массивами.
  • И многое другое.

Зачем нужен DigitalOcean

DigitalOcean будем использовать для запуска нод разных проектов. Преимущество данного сервира в том, что на 60 дней команда дает 200$ для тестирования платформы. Это нам очень подходит для развертывания ноды для проекта Nubit.

Регистрация

1. Переходим на сайт - нам сразу предлагает за регистрацию 200$ на 60 дней

2. Проходим регистрацию через google аккаунт, подвязываем банковскую карту для верификации (при завершении регистрации с карты спишут ~15$ и вернут назад сразу, без этого не пройдем верификацию). Можно сказать, что проходим так KYC.

Настройка платформы DigitalOcean

Настраиваем нашу платформу, на примере проекта Nubit:

  • Нажимаем New Project
  • Задаем имя проекта и жмем Create project
  • Пропускаем (Skip for now)
  • Настраиваем наш проект. Переходим в наш проект Nubit и через Create создаем Droplets
  • Настраиваем:

Choose Region -> Frankfurt (выбираете по своему желанию)

Choose an image -> Marketplace (234) -> Docker on Ubuntu 22.04

Choose Size -> не трогаем

CPU options -> Regular и выбираем сервер за 6$

Переходим в Choose Authentication Method и задаем пароль

Переходим в Finalize Details и выбираем количество серверов. Жмем Create Droplet

Работа с сервером

  • Ждем создания сервера
  • Переходим в один с серверов
  • Запускаем консоль
  • Настраиваем сервер командами. Каждую команду запускаем отдельно

- Создаем папку Nubit Light Node

mkdir nubit-light-node

- Заходим в ранее созданную папку

cd nubit-light-node

- Скачиваем Docker File

wget -O Dockerfile https://raw.githubusercontent.com/g-group-vip/Scripts/main/Nodes/Nubit/Dockerfile.setup

- Запускаем Docker File. Ждем окончания 11 процессов

docker build --no-cache -t nubit_service . && docker run -d --name nubit_light --restart always nubit_service

- Запускаем команду проверки Logs

docker logs -f --tail=100 nubit_light

После запуска ноды нам генерирует данные, которые следует сохранить у себя на компьютере. Нода должна поработать минимум 15 мин

Удаление ненужного сервера

Переходим к списку серверов

Жмем More -> Destroy

Жмем Destroy this Droplet

Вводим название нашего сервера и жмем Destroy

Повторяем шаги для следующих серверов

🔍 Эту статью подготовила для вас команда G_Group. Хотите быть в курсе последних новостей, руководств и информации о криптовалютах, DeFi, NFT и P2E? Присоединяйтесь к нашему сообществу.

Telegram | Chat |Twitter | Facebook | Instagram | YouTube |